you’re COLOR is a picture book about finding color and happiness. For ages 7+ you’re COLOR is a children’s book set in a familiar far off place. A boy with a beard, the boy being named Griz, lives in a world that’s pretty black and white. There you have to find your color. Through the eyes of his dog Otter, Griz finds color in different people and places as he figures out which colors stick like they should.

This app features narration and music set behind a beautifully illustrated world. Children will be able finger swipe through the pages and read the words that Otter narrates. The subtle sounds of the storybook world accompany the readers as they pour over the detailed full color drawings. From the menu at the bottom or by touching each page, kids can turn the narration on or off for guided or independent reading. There is a page slider to jump to your favorite pages, and a link to visit yourecolor.com to find free art activities and lessons.

About the book:

It’s about the good times and stormy times in life and how the different colors in our lives may come and go, but we always find a favorite.  Maybe you’ve moved away from friends, lost a loved one, or you’re simply feeling blue.  Just remember, you’re COLOR!

The book will be a collection of digitally painted, watercolored, and inked drawings that guide the reader through a black and white world where the things we do, and people we know color our lives. It’s a book that can be enjoyed by children of all ages, but specifically geared towards students 8 to 10 years of age. The book will not only teach children how to color their lives with happiness, but about color theory and elements of art as well. It will have an alternative exciting layout that is more conducive to  classroom reading and displaying during instruction.  The book will be 24 pages with 12 full page illustrations and 12 pages of illustrated text. I will self-publish the book through Amazon’s Createspace, as well as submit it to publishers and local bookstores.
